SO Scared Last Night!

May 27, 2014

Yesterday evening, I cooked pan seared talapia and scrambled eggs for my dinner.  I had only eaten maybe 3 or 4 bites and was already full.  That's pretty normal.  But then about 15 minutes later, I started having these painful pressure 'bubble's in my chest cavity and then rolling down to my upper stomach.  I sat there for a while hoping it would go away.  But it would get stronger and more frequently.  So, I called the surgeon's exchange hoping to speak to a nurse.  However, the surgeon called me back!  Side Note:  Dr. Mario Morales is the greatest!  He is so patient and thorough and I really felt he was genuinely concerned when he called.  I was surprised at that.  But I told him what I was experiencing and he said. . .for one. . .I shouldn't be eating fish at this point.  I'm 3 weeks post op (today).  The scrambled eggs were ok. . .but not the fish.  He believes I either ate too much of it or ate it too quickly and that it was too much for my pouch.  That's exactly what it felt like. . .it felt like my pouch was stretching and compacting trying to push the food through. . .and it hurt SO bad.  I was so afraid that I had somehow 'broken' my pouch and my surgery would be for naught!!  But he said not to worry, it won't 'break' that easily.  But for the next week, until my 30 day checkup, he wants me to go back to straight liquids to give it time to rest and recover from that mini-trauma.  So I'm forced to suffer through these protein shakes and liquid protein drinks until my visit with him on June 10th (which is actually 3 days past my 30 day point).

As bad as I felt last night, I don't have a problem with the liquid.  I almost feel like I never want to eat again . . .the pain was that intense.
